The dimmable LED module represents a revolutionary advancement in modern lighting technology, offering unprecedented control over illumination intensity while maintaining energy efficiency. This innovative lighting solution integrates advanced dimming capabilities with high-performance LED technology, creating a versatile component suitable for diverse applications. The dimmable LED module operates through sophisticated electronic circuits that regulate current flow to the LED chips, enabling seamless brightness adjustment from complete darkness to maximum luminosity. These modules incorporate cutting-edge PWM (Pulse Width Modulation) technology or analog dimming methods, ensuring smooth transitions without flickering or color temperature shifts. The technological architecture includes premium LED chips, precision drivers, and intelligent control systems that work harmoniously to deliver consistent performance. Modern dimmable LED modules feature compatibility with various control protocols including DALI, DMX, and wireless systems, making them ideal for smart building integration. The modules are engineered with thermal management systems that prevent overheating, extending operational lifespan beyond 50,000 hours. Their compact design allows easy integration into existing fixtures while providing superior light quality with high CRI ratings exceeding 90. Advanced PWM Dimming Technology for Flicker-Free Performance

Advanced PWM Dimming Technology for Flicker-Free Performance

The dimmable LED module incorporates state-of-the-art PWM (Pulse Width Modulation) dimming technology that delivers smooth, flicker-free brightness control across the entire dimming range. This sophisticated technology rapidly switches the LED on and off at frequencies exceeding 1000Hz, creating the perception of dimmed light while maintaining consistent color temperature and quality. Unlike traditional phase-cut dimming methods that can cause flickering, color shifting, or compatibility issues with electronic devices, PWM dimming ensures stable performance that protects eye health and reduces visual fatigue. The advanced PWM controller continuously monitors electrical parameters and automatically adjusts switching patterns to compensate for variations in power supply or environmental conditions. This intelligent feedback system maintains precise brightness levels even when multiple dimmable LED modules operate simultaneously on the same circuit. The technology eliminates the annoying buzz or hum associated with conventional dimming systems, creating silent operation that enhances comfort in residential and commercial environments. Professional photographers and videographers particularly value this flicker-free performance because it prevents interference with cameras and recording equipment that can detect lighting fluctuations invisible to the human eye. Medical facilities benefit from the stable light output that supports accurate color perception during examinations and surgical procedures. The PWM dimming system extends the operational lifespan of LED chips by reducing thermal stress and maintaining optimal operating conditions. This technology enables dimming down to 1% of maximum brightness without compromising light quality or causing the LED to flicker or shut off unexpectedly. Restaurant owners and hospitality managers appreciate the ability to create intimate dining atmospheres without sacrificing light quality or experiencing the warm color shifts that plague inferior dimming systems. The dimmable LED module with PWM technology integrates seamlessly with building management systems, allowing centralized control of large lighting installations while maintaining individual zone flexibility. Energy savings multiply significantly when combined with occupancy sensors and daylight harvesting systems that automatically adjust brightness based on natural light levels and room occupancy, maximizing efficiency without compromising user comfort or productivity.
Universal Compatibility with Multiple Control Systems

Universal Compatibility with Multiple Control Systems

The dimmable LED module features exceptional compatibility with diverse control systems, making it the ideal choice for both retrofit projects and new installations across residential, commercial, and industrial applications. This universal compatibility eliminates the guesswork and compatibility concerns that often plague lighting upgrades, ensuring seamless integration with existing infrastructure. The module supports traditional leading-edge and trailing-edge dimmers commonly found in homes and offices, allowing property owners to upgrade to efficient LED technology without replacing wall switches or control panels. Advanced compatibility extends to professional lighting control protocols including DALI (Digital Addressable Lighting Interface), DMX512, and 0-10V analog dimming systems used in commercial buildings and entertainment venues. This versatility enables lighting designers to specify dimmable LED modules with confidence, knowing they will integrate perfectly with architectural lighting control systems. Smart home enthusiasts benefit from native compatibility with popular home automation platforms including Zigbee, Z-Wave, and WiFi-based systems that enable smartphone control, voice activation through Alexa or Google Assistant, and programmable scheduling for enhanced convenience and energy savings. The dimmable LED module automatically detects the connected control system and optimizes its operation accordingly, eliminating complex configuration procedures that typically require technical expertise. Building managers appreciate the ability to integrate these modules into existing BMS (Building Management Systems) without requiring expensive control panel upgrades or extensive rewiring. The universal compatibility extends to emergency lighting systems, allowing the dimmable LED module to seamlessly switch to full brightness during power outages or emergency situations while maintaining normal dimming operation during regular use. International installations benefit from compatibility with global voltage standards and frequency variations, ensuring reliable performance regardless of local electrical infrastructure. The module's intelligent control circuitry prevents damage from incompatible dimmers or electrical surges while providing diagnostic feedback that helps identify system issues before they cause failures. Hospitality applications particularly value the compatibility with centralized lighting management systems that enable hotel staff to preset lighting scenes for different times of day or special events while allowing individual room control for guest comfort.
Superior Thermal Management for Extended Lifespan

Superior Thermal Management for Extended Lifespan

The dimmable LED module incorporates advanced thermal management systems that ensure optimal operating temperatures and maximize component lifespan, delivering exceptional value through reduced maintenance costs and superior reliability. Heat represents the primary enemy of LED performance and longevity, making effective thermal management crucial for maintaining light output and preventing premature failures that plague inferior LED products. The module features precision-engineered heat sinks manufactured from high-grade aluminum alloys with optimized fin designs that maximize surface area for efficient heat dissipation. These heat sinks undergo specialized treatments that enhance thermal conductivity while providing corrosion resistance for long-term durability in challenging environments. Strategic component placement positions heat-generating elements away from temperature-sensitive circuits while creating thermal pathways that channel heat away from critical components. The thermal management system includes temperature monitoring sensors that continuously track operating conditions and automatically adjust performance parameters to prevent overheating damage. When ambient temperatures rise beyond safe operating limits, the system gradually reduces power output to maintain safe operating conditions while preserving LED chip integrity. This intelligent thermal protection extends operational lifespan beyond 50,000 hours even in demanding applications with elevated ambient temperatures or limited ventilation. The dimmable LED module utilizes premium thermal interface materials that maintain consistent heat transfer properties throughout the product lifecycle, preventing thermal resistance increases that commonly affect lower-quality LED products. Advanced thermal modeling during the design phase ensures optimal heat flow patterns and identifies potential hot spots before they affect real-world performance. Industrial applications benefit from robust thermal management that maintains consistent light output despite temperature variations in manufacturing environments, warehouses, or outdoor installations. The superior thermal design enables higher power densities without compromising reliability, allowing the dimmable LED module to deliver more light output from compact form factors compared to thermally-limited competitors. Retail environments appreciate the consistent color temperature and brightness levels that thermal management provides, ensuring merchandise appears attractively illuminated throughout the day regardless of ambient temperature changes. The thermal management system contributes significantly to energy efficiency by maintaining optimal LED chip operating temperatures where luminous efficacy peaks, maximizing light output per watt consumed and reducing overall system energy requirements for achieving desired illumination levels.
